Cayo Diablo (reef stop)
📍 Fajardo

Cayo Diablo (reef stop)

🚶 boat access

Beach Features

SecludedSnorkelingDiving

Current Conditions

Sargassum: No SargassumSurf: Small WavesWind: Calm

About This Beach

Reef and sand tongues popular for snorkel tours; limited sandy landing spots. (Tour ops; OSM)

← Back to Beach Finder
Coordinates: 18.3708, -65.5588Updated: 9/23/2025

More Beaches in Fajardo

Discover other beautiful beaches in Fajardo

Cayo Icacos (La Cordillera)
Fajardo

Cayo Icacos (La Cordillera)

SecludedSnorkelingScenic
No SargassumSmall WavesCalm
Playa Escondida (Fajardo)
Fajardo

Playa Escondida (Fajardo)

SecludedScenic
No SargassumMedium WavesCalm
Playa Colora (Fajardo)
Fajardo

Playa Colora (Fajardo)

SecludedScenic
No SargassumMedium WavesCalm
Seven Seas Beach
Fajardo

Seven Seas Beach

Family FriendlyScenicCamping
No SargassumSmall WavesLight Breeze
ParkingRestroomsShowersLifeguard
Cabezas de San Juan Reserve Shore
Fajardo

Cabezas de San Juan Reserve Shore

Scenic
No SargassumSmall WavesCalm
Las Croabas Waterfront
Fajardo

Las Croabas Waterfront

Scenic
No SargassumCalmLight Breeze
Parking